does anyone know if a 72 a-body steering box will fit onto a 64 a-body

I believe it will bolt on but from what I run into is the taper on the pitman arm is a little differant than the taper on tie-rod. I tried to swap the pitman arms and found the shafts out of the boxes were differant diameters also. So i waited and came across a 66 p/s box. Hope this is of help, Rick...

I have a 66 Malibu and about 15 years ago I did some upgrades on the suspension. I used a power steering gearbox out of a 78 Trans Am. I had to change pitman arms, but the splines matched up on the "new" box ok. I think the GM gearboxes for front steer cars will interchange up to 81. I could be wrong on that, but the TA box worked great on my car, as well as the big front sway bar.

When changing steering boxes, you have to keep the pitman arms with the box. the difference is in the shaft diameter. a manual box arm will not interchange with the power box arm. I've made the swap many times.
